Specification breakdown

SpecTurboAnt X7 MaxThe Levy Plus
Range (mi)18 mi19.6 mi
Top speed (mph)18.6 mph19.2 mph
Weight (lbs)34.4 lbs30.8 lbs
Motor power (W)350 W350 W
Battery capacity (Wh)360 Wh460 Wh
BrakesDiscDisc
TiresPneumaticPneumatic
Waterproof ratingIPX4IP54
SuspensionNoneNone
Price (USD)$540$749
